The Atlantic Meridional Overturning Circulation (AMOC) is a major tipping element in the present-day climate and could potentially collapse under sufficient freshwater or CO 2 forcing. While the effect of the Bering Strait on AMOC stability has been well studied, it is unknown whether a constructed closure of this Strait can prevent an AMOC collapse under climate change.
